Transaction 8c91da52ffcf1f4d0b05b4e39a896b9e3142813f0062ae4d57a1f0f35cf8315a
1 Input
1 Output
-
8c91da52ffcf1f4d0b05b4e39a896b9e3142813f0062ae4d57a1f0f35cf8315a:0
- value
- 334144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88444a2257385d3fc4b86b475f278c0d4406c9b6 OP_EQUAL
- address
- 3E7XdUafyaZYe7Qwn4TaH1apZBav8CmjB3